Transaction 3d8ec9e6c8d42fb563700af2d20059aecc6871c21c76fa4574ca64de74969951
1 Input
1 Output
-
3d8ec9e6c8d42fb563700af2d20059aecc6871c21c76fa4574ca64de74969951:0
- value
- 32418
- script pubkey
- OP_0 OP_PUSHBYTES_20 66d2394351b62ad83ad445519694c2f5e1e51f6b
- address
- bc1qvmfrjs63kc4dswk5g4ged9xz7hs728mtzqe9pa